Utensil: Grater

A dependable grater is one of the most versatile tools in any kitchen, turning humble roots and stubborn blocks of cheese into delicate strands that cooking heat transforms in minutes. Shredding drastically increases surface area, allowing ingredients to absorb dressings faster, cook evenly, and release maximum flavor without requiring tedious knife work on busy weeknights.

Unlocking the best results often comes down to matching the grate size to your dish. Coarser shreds give body and satisfying bite to fritters and hash browns, while a fine rasp yields airy citrus zest or cheese that melts effortlessly into emulsified sauces.
